general design
Apr 254 min read

Architecture to UI/UX Design: Must-Have Tools and Software Explained

written by

Team Kaarwan

The fields of architecture and UI/UX design share many similarities in their emphasis on user-centered design and attention to detail. As architects transition into the world of UI/UX design, it's essential to equip themselves with the right tools and software to excel in this new domain. The article, explores the must-have tools and software for aspiring UI/UX designers, providing insights into how each tool can enhance the design process and lead to better user experiences.

What is UI/UX Design

Before diving into the tools, it's important to grasp the basics of UI/UX design. User interface design (UI) focuses on the visual aspects of a product, including layout, typography, and color schemes, to create an intuitive and visually appealing interface for users. User experience design (UX), on the other hand, centers on how users interact with a product, aiming to provide a seamless and enjoyable experience.

Essential UI/UX Design Tools

When it comes to UI/UX design, having the right tools at your disposal can significantly enhance your design process and the final outcome of your projects. The following are some of the most essential tools for UI/UX design, along with their key features and benefits:

A graphic design of a hand holding a smartphone with vibrant user-centered digital experiences and floating graphic elements around it set against a dark background.jpg

Image source_ⓒFreepik.com

Sketch:

Overview: Sketch is a vector-based design tool widely used for creating user interfaces. It offers a clean and intuitive interface, making it easy for designers to create wireframes, prototypes, and high-fidelity designs.

Features: Sketch provides a range of design tools such as symbols, art boards, and reusable components. It also supports collaborative work through shared libraries and version control.

Integrations: Sketch integrates with various plugins and design systems, allowing for efficient handoff to developers.

Adobe XD:

Overview: Adobe XD is a versatile design tool that supports both UI and UX design. It offers a comprehensive suite of design features and seamless integration with other Adobe Creative Cloud applications.

Features: Adobe XD provides responsive design tools, interactive prototyping, and the ability to create dynamic content. It also supports real-time collaboration and design sharing.

Prototyping: Designers can create interactive prototypes with transitions and animations to simulate the user experience.

Figma:

Overview: Figma is a collaborative design tool that enables designers to work together in real-time on a single project. It is cloud-based, making it easy for team members to access and collaborate from anywhere.

Features: Figma offers vector editing tools, components, and responsive design capabilities. Its robust commenting system and version history facilitate effective collaboration.

Sharing: Figma allows for easy sharing of designs with stakeholders for feedback and review.

A colorful graphic displaying a smartphone and UI elements exemplifying UIUX design with icons and graphics representing tools and metrics in a vibrant purple setting.jpg

Image source_ⓒFreepik.com

InVision:

Overview: InVision is known for its prototyping and collaboration capabilities. It allows designers to create interactive and animated prototypes to simulate user interactions.

Features: InVision offers a design system manager for maintaining consistency across projects. It also supports feedback and comments directly on designs for seamless collaboration.

Collaboration: InVision's collaborative features enable smooth communication between designers, developers, and other stakeholders.

Axure RP:

Overview: Axure RP is a comprehensive prototyping tool that allows designers to create complex, interactive prototypes. It is suitable for advanced projects that require custom interactions and conditional logic.

Features: Axure RP supports dynamic content, animations, and adaptive views for responsive design. It also offers documentation features to annotate designs and provide detailed specifications.

User Testing: Axure's advanced prototyping capabilities make it ideal for conducting user testing and refining designs based on feedback.

These essential UI/UX design tools provide a wide range of functionalities to support the entire design process, from ideation to prototyping and testing. Leveraging the strengths of each tool, designers can create intuitive, engaging, and user-friendly digital experiences.

A woman using a laptop with colorful graphical user interface elements floating above the screen symbolizing user-centered digital experiences.jpg

Image source_ⓒFreepik.com

Learning and Mastering UI/UX Design

To effectively learn and master UI/UX design, consider taking online courses or certification programs. These resources provide in-depth knowledge of design principles, methodologies, and best practices. Practicing hands-on projects and seeking feedback from peers can also help improve your skills.

Best Practices in UI Design

Consistency: Maintain consistency in design elements such as fonts, colors, and icons to create a cohesive user experience.

Simplicity: Keep designs simple and focused, avoiding unnecessary elements that may confuse users.

Accessibility: Design with accessibility in mind, ensuring that all users can interact with the product effectively.

Best Practices in UX Design

User Research: Conduct thorough user research to understand user needs, preferences, and pain points.

Testing and Iteration: Continuously test and iterate on designs based on user feedback to improve the overall user experience.

Information Architecture: Organize content logically to help users navigate the product intuitively.

Conclusion

Transitioning from architecture to UI/UX design can be a rewarding journey, offering the opportunity to create impactful and user-centered digital experiences. Making use of the right tools and software, and following best practices in UI/UX design, architects can excel in this new field and make meaningful contributions to the design world. 

Hey architects, unleash your creative potential in UI/UX design! Kaarwan’s UI-UX Design Certification & Job Support Program equips you with the skills and tools to design user-friendly digital experiences.  Become a well-rounded designer. Enroll now!

Visit the Kaarwan website for more insights!

Subscribe to our newsletter for the latest information about course announcements, discounts and enlightening blogs!

Team Kaarwan

Team Kaarwan

Since we graduated from IIT Roorkee, we have been on a mission to democratize education through affordable online and offline workshops on industry-relevant skills, that help students gain better employability across the Indian subcontinent!